Calgary Flames vs Seattle Kraken Recap - Flames Win 4-3

The Flames beat Seattle 4-3 on Monday, earning a victory backstopped by Dan Vladar's 28 saves.

The Flames were a -105 underdog in the win. The combined score went OVER the total, which closed at 6.5.

Rasmus Andersson, Jonathan Huberdeau, Elias Lindholm, and Andrew Mangiapane each scored for the Flames in the victory. Lindholm opened the scoring for Calgary.

Dan Vladar turned in a 28-save effort for the Flames.

Seattle got goals from Jordan Eberle, Jared McCann, and Vince Dunn in the loss, but it wasn't enough.

Seattle got a 22-stop effort from Joey Daccord in the loss.

On the power play, Calgary went 1-for-2, while the Kraken were 0-for-2 with the man advantage.

Seattle outshot Calgary 31-31 in the game.
